Hi all.

Well, it seems I've managed to kill my speedo.

I gave the engine bay a bit of a spring clean with my favourite pound shop cleaner of choice, gave it a rinse with water from a kettle (i.e not doused with the hose) and now my speedo has died.

No signal to info centre either.

The car in question is a 460 Turbo Auto, but has the same running gear as a 480.

So, is the speedo sensor so fragile that even a little bit of water kills it immediately?!

This was a couple of days ago now, so would have thought it would have dried out by now.

The speedo sensor is a sealed plastic unit so no the water should not have damaged it .

Is it dead altogether now then? If it doesn't move at all may be the speed sensor.....but if it moves a bit might be something wrong inside the instrument cluster
